I have two questions:
1. What would be a good value to assume for the shear modulus of a sandy clay?
2. Would you ever design a foundation without a geotech report?

2. IBC (if that is what you use) permits you to assume values without a report. I have done it but don't like it and think it is bizarre we have to jump through so many hoops for other calculations then it allows you to just assume a soil bearing capacity for a site.

Explain to the owner he can either pay for the $2K-$5K report now or pay for it in construction since you will be putting it on your drawing that the contractor must confirm it before construction. The downside in waiting is that you may also incur charges for redesigning foundations if the existing conditions do not meet your assumptions.

GEOTECHNICAL
A GEOTECHNICAL REPORT HAS NOT BEEN PREPARED FOR THIS SITE. THE CONTRACTOR, THROUGH THE CLIENT IS RESPONSIBLE FOR OBTAINING A GEOTECHNICAL REPORT TO CONFIRM DESIGN ASSUMPTIONS. THE [CONSULTANT | ENGINEER] ASSUMES NO LIABILITY FOR THESE DESIGN ASSUMPTIONS OR FOR ANY FOUNDATION REDESIGN NECESSITATED BY DIFFERING SOIL CONDITIONS
FOUNDATION DESIGN IS IN ACCORDANCE WITH THE GEOTECHNICAL REPORT PREPARED BY XXX, HAVING A FILE No.xxx AND DATED XXX. THE CONTRACTOR SHALL REFER TO THE INFORMATION CONTAINED IN THIS GEOTECHNICAL REPORT AND SUPPLEMENT IT AS REQUIRED. THE CONTRACTOR SHALL REVIEW THE GEOTECHNICAL REPORT AND FOLLOW THE RECOMMENDATIONS WITHIN THE REPORT PRIOR TO PROCEEDING WITH ANY FOUNDATION WORK
FOUNDATION WORK SHALL BE INSPECTED BY A QUALIFIED [CONSULTANT | ENGINEER] TO CONFIRM THE DESIGN ASSUMPTIONS PRIOR TO PLACING CONC
FOUNDATIONS (GENERAL)
SOIL CLASSIFICATION (CASSAGRANDE) IS SIMILAR TO xxx
REPORT ANY INCONSISTENCIES IN THE FOUNDATION SOIL MATRIX TO THE [CONSULTANT | ENGINEER] AN PROCEED ONLY ON HIS INSTRUCTIONS
IF UNSUITABLE MATERIAL OR GROUNDWATER IS ENCOUNTERED DURING FOUNDATION EXCAVATION, CONTRACTOR SHALL NOTIFY THE [CONSULTANT | ENGINEER] IMMEDIATELY BEFORE CONTINUING WITH CONSTRUCTION. OVER EXCAVATE AS REQUIRED AND INSTALL A PERIMETER DITCH AND PUMP AS REQD
PROTECT FOUNDATIONS AND ADJACENT SOIL AGAINST FREEZING AND FROST ACTION AT ALL TIMES DURING CONSTRUCTION
FOUNDATIONS SHALL BE PLACED:
NOT MORE THAN [3 | 75] OFF CENTRE
NOT MORE THAN 2% OF THEIR LENGTH OUT OF PLUMB
FOUNDATIONS SHALL BE CENTRED UNDER COLS AND WALLS UNLESS SHOWN OTHERWISE
THE CONTRACTOR SHALL MECHANICALLY VIBRATE ALL FOUNDATION CONC TO CONSOLIDATE IT AND TO CREATE AN UNINTERRUPTED BEARING SURFACE
FOUNDATIONS SHALL NOT BE CONSTRUCTED ON/IN FROZEN SOIL. THE CONTRACTOR SHALL ADEQUATELY PROTECT FOUNDATIONS AND FILL MATERIALS AGAINST FREEZING
ROCK OBSTRUCTIONS MAY BE PRESENT ON SITE. CONTRACTOR SHALL INCLUDE FOR THE REMOVAL OF ALL ROCK OBSTRUCTIONS ENCOUNTERED HAVING A MAXIMUM VOLUME OF 0.5 CUBIC METRES (17.7 CUBIC FEET)
PROVIDE [6FT | 1,9M] MIN OF BACKFILL FOR FROST PROTECTION U/N
WHERE REQD, THE CONTRACTOR WILL MAKE ALL NECESSARY PROVISIONS TO ALLOW DIRECT INSPECTION OF THE BEARING STRATA
THE GENERAL CONTRACTOR IS RESPONSIBLE FOR FOUNDING ELEVS FOR FOOTINGS AND CUT-OFF ELEVS FOR ALL PILES
FOUNDATIONS AND DRAINAGE (FOR PWF FOUNDATIONS)
SOIL BEARING PRESSURE IS 1500 PSF EXCEPT AS NOTED ON PLAN
MODULUS OF SUBGRADE REACTION IS 150 PCI EXCEPT AS NOTED ON PLAN
FOUNDATION BEARING SHALL BE ON UNDISTURBED NATIVE SOIL AND SHALL BE HAND EXCAVATED FOR THE FINAL [6 | 150]
